Exercise reduced abnormal responses to temperature and pressure - both characteristic of neuropathic pain.Įxercise also led to reduced expression of inflammation-promoting cytokines in sciatic nerve tissue - specifically, tumor necrosis factor-alpha and interleukin-1-beta. The results suggested significant reductions in neuropathic pain in rats assigned to swimming or treadmill running. The researchers assessed the effects of exercise on neuropathic pain severity by monitoring observable pain behaviors. After nerve injury, some animals performed progressive exercise - either swimming or treadmill running - over a few weeks. Phantom limb pain after amputation is an example of neuropathic pain.ĭr Chen and colleagues examined the effects of exercise on neuropathic pain induced by sciatic nerve injury in rats. The lead author was Yu-Wen Chen, PhD, of China Medical University, Taichung, Taiwan.Įxercise Reduces Nerve Pain and Cytokine Expression in Rats Neuropathic pain is a common and difficult-to-treat type of pain caused by nerve damage, seen in patients with trauma, diabetes, and other conditions. The results support exercise as a potentially useful nondrug treatment for neuropathic pain, and suggest that it may work by reducing inflammation-promoting substances called cytokines.
